The rapper Killer Mike, who won three awards this Sunday night, the 4th, was escorted out of the Grammys wearing handcuffs

The rapper Killer Mike was escorted out of the Grammy wearing handcuffs, last Sunday, 4. According to the TMZ, he was detained after a “physical altercation” with a security guard at the event, who reportedly didn’t get out of his way quickly. The musician was charged with a misdemeanor and released four and a half hours later.

Mike received the award for Best Rap Song and Best Rap Performance for “Scientists & Engineers”, and Best Rap Album for Michael (2023) (via Variety). He added the achievement in the album title on streaming platforms:
